From the continent of Asia to the pacific islands, members and friends in the Asia North area heard the words of the Prophet, Apostles, and other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ints' leaders during the 192nd semiannual General Conference broadcast April 2022, reaching to the isles of the sea in a variety of ways.

Every six months the Church's General Conference broadcast expands its reach further to remote locations, giving opportunity for more people to 'Hear Him.' 

Throughout the Asia North Area, General Conference was watched and heard in a variety of ways. Families gathered in their homes near their televisions to hear the Prophet and other church leaders. Babies and toddlers were held by parents or siblings, families, and couples cuddled on sofas, children participated in other quiet activities such as coloring sitting or lying on the floor while feeling the loving bonds of their family. Others met in their chapels and stake centers where conference was being streamed. Members, friends, and missionary companionships watched on their cellphones, tablets, PC's and laptops via the Church's website and YouTube channels in their respective languages. This conference, the Saturday evening session was held as a general session focused on women.

One sister shares her sentiments, “General Conference is always great for me. Although my little ones can feel a bit overwhelming, I take the opportunity of listening to a good conference talk via YouTube. It's great to have family over and we share what we like about the conference.” ~ Raynna Oveny, Saipan 

Guam and Palau’s friendly relations with media-broadcasting stations has proven helpful to expand the Conference coverage by adding additional sessions to be viewed. Members in the island of Pohnpei met in their chapels where General Conference was being streamed. Be it in a home, in a car, or outside under shade trees, 'His words' were heard by many countries.
